Some Aspects Of Behavior And Social Groups is a book written by Frederick Archibald Dewey and first published in 1915. The book explores the relationship between behavior and social groups, examining how individuals behave differently when they are part of a group as opposed to when they are alone. Dewey argues that social groups have a profound impact on human behavior, shaping our values, beliefs, and actions in ways that are often unconscious. He also discusses the role of social norms, customs, and traditions in shaping behavior and the importance of socialization in the development of individuals. The book is a seminal work in the field of sociology and has been widely cited and referenced by scholars in the social sciences.
